Output 0b3118876a41db28d19d36efa074f55e064e729f34eb25c2557cdc0b200eca5a:1

value
9299221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d29b61fbc437320358c754157486bd3c75019aa OP_EQUAL
address
3MrRE6gAsBfpnaZVBj2FHCUG7aJNWbL8XD
transaction
0b3118876a41db28d19d36efa074f55e064e729f34eb25c2557cdc0b200eca5a
spent
true